本文关于网络安全全解析:深入理解加密原理、算法与协议,据
亚洲金融智库2025-01-15日讯:
网络安全的重要性
在当今数字化时代,网络安全已成为保护个人隐私和企业数据的关键。随着网络攻击的日益增多,理解加密技术的基本原理、算法和协议变得尤为重要。本文将深入探讨这些核心概念,帮助读者构建更安全的网络环境。
加密原理基础
加密技术是网络安全的基石,它通过将信息转换为不可读的格式来保护数据不被未授权访问。加密过程涉及两个主要元素:加密算法和密钥。加密算法是数学函数,用于将原始数据(明文)转换为加密数据(密文),而密钥则是控制加密和解密过程的参数。
常见的加密算法
目前,有多种加密算法被广泛应用于网络安全领域,主要包括:
- 对称加密算法:如AES(高级加密标准),使用相同的密钥进行加密和解密,速度快,适合大量数据的加密。
- 非对称加密算法:如RSA,使用一对密钥,即公钥和私钥,公钥用于加密,私钥用于解密,安全性更高。
- 哈希函数:如SHA-256,用于生成数据的唯一指纹,常用于验证数据完整性。
加密协议的作用
加密协议是定义如何在网络中安全传输数据的规则和标准。常见的加密协议包括:
- SSL/TLS:用于保护网络通信,如HTTPS网站的安全连接。
- IPSec:用于保护IP层的数据传输,常用于VPN连接。
- SSH:用于安全的远程登录和其他网络服务。
加密技术的挑战与未来
尽管加密技术提供了强大的数据保护,但它也面临着量子计算等新兴技术的挑战。量子计算机可能在未来破解现有的加密算法,因此,研究人员正在开发抗量子加密技术以应对这一威胁。
感谢您阅读本文,希望通过对加密原理、算法与协议的深入解析,您能更好地理解网络安全的重要性,并采取有效措施保护您的数据安全。如果您对网络安全有更多兴趣,可以进一步探索网络安全策略、防火墙配置等话题。
专题推荐: